In brief the property comprises; a welcoming, extended entrance hallway with a staircase rising to the first floor. A lounge with a feature gas fireplace and a window overlooking the front aspect allowing light to flood the room. Double doors which lead into a snug or further versatile reception room. This opens to the stylish and extended kitchen diner with central island and integrated appliances. There are patio doors which lead out to the generous rear garden. A utility room with plumbing for a washing machine and condensing dryer. A downstairs w.c. and a door leading to the integral garage.
To the first floor, there are three good size bedrooms. Two of which are generous doubles with fitted wardrobes. A stylish, fully tiled house bathroom with a four piece suite in white.
To the second floor is the master bedroom with stunning views through a Juliet balcony overlooking the golf course woodlands. A fully tiled en suite with an impressive three piece suite including a generous walk in shower.
Externally the property sits on an enviable plot. To the front, a lawned garden and driveway for multiple off road parking which leads to the integral garage. To the rear, an impressive garden, directly adjoining Moortown golf course. Mainly laid to lawn with well established shrubbery and borders, a lovely patio area ideal for alfresco dining and entertaining with views over the woodlands beyond. All enjoying a good degree of privacy.

Broadband availability and predicted speed
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ength
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
